Alstroemeria 'Prima Donna'
Alstroemeria hybri
'Prima Donna'
Alstroemeria 'Prima Donna' is an ornamental plant with beautiful flowers, characterized by blooming in various colors. The following is information regarding the main characteristics and cultivation of this variety. Growth Characteristics - Growth Form: A perennial herbaceous plant that propagates via rhizomes. It can grow to a height of approximately 30 to 90 cm. - Flowers: Flowers bloom in various colors and feature unique patterns on the petals. - Flowering Period: It primarily blooms from spring to autumn and can bloom multiple times under suitable conditions. - Light: It thrives in sunny locations but can tolerate some shade. Propagation Methods - Rhizome Division: Propagated by dividing the underground stems. Generally, it is best to divide in early spring or autumn. - Seeds: It can also be propagated by seeds, but rhizome division is generally preferred due to the low germination rate. Cultivation Methods - Soil: It prefers well-drained soil, and slightly acidic or neutral soil is suitable. - Watering: It is important to maintain moderate moisture and avoid overwatering. - Fertilizer: During the growing season, use a balanced fertilizer to provide proper nutrition. - Temperature: It prefers cool climates but can tolerate somewhat hot summers. Excessive cold should be avoided during the winter. Uses in the Garden - Flowerbeds and Borders: Its colorful flowers add vibrancy to the garden, making it suitable for flowerbeds or border areas. - Cut Flowers: It is also popular as a cut flower because the blooms last a long time. Important Pests and Diseases & Control Methods - Diseases: Root rot and fungal diseases may occur. Proper drainage and maintaining a clean environment are important. - Pests: Aphids and slugs can cause problems. - Control Methods: Early detection through regular observation, using eco-friendly insecticides, or washing with water can be effective.
